Dr. Richard Wells, Regional Supervising Coroner, Central Region, Toronto West Office, announced today that a date has been scheduled for the inquest into the death of Dustin McMillan.

Mr. McMillan, 36 years old, died on June 29, 2018, while in custody at Toronto South Detention Centre. An inquest into his death is mandatory under the Coroners Act.

The inquest will examine the circumstances surrounding Mr. McMillan's death. The jury may make recommendations aimed at preventing further deaths.

The inquest will begin at 9:30 a.m. on Monday, September 9, 2024. Dr. Geoffrey Bond will be the presiding officer and Julian Roy will be the inquest counsel.

The inquest is expected to last five days and hear from approximately eight witnesses.

The inquest will be conducted by video conference. Members of the public who wish to view the proceedings can do so live at the link provided below:
